Case Study 1: High Speed B2B Integration & Global Visibility
 
Straight-through-processing (STP) Solutions should provide fast, reliable, direct delivery of transactions and other business information with absolutely minimal need for human intervention. At the same time intervention on an exception basis needs to be catered for whilst also providing visibility, to all who need it, within today’s global operations.

Option Computers has encountered many organizations where, over the years, the implementation of tactical solutions and the addressing of short term needs have led to fragmented integration of both delivery and communication of business information. In today’s technology driven world, many banks still find themselves having to process transactions manually, such as faxing dealing information around the globe. But does it need to be this way?

As part of a strategic policy review, one major international bank decided that significant parts of its existing infrastructure were unwieldy and, in many respects, redundant as well as suffering from reliability and performance issues.
 
However, elements of the incumbent infrastructure were used for mission critical delivery of FX trade tickets from around the world to its global risk management service and so the virtually obsolete system could not be switched off. Apart from the inherent risks, this created high maintenance costs for both software and hardware. In addition, feeds from other services were being handled by largely disparate systems leading to further duplication of resources.

After researching the marketplace, the Bank identified Option Computers (OCL) as the leading supplier of ticket and conversation feed handling solutions to the world’s major FX banks.

Following this, OCL proposed a solution based on its flagship B2B integration product - DealHub.

Key factors in the Banks’ choice of OCL were:

  • OCL’s committment to handle additional services as these come to the market.


  • Dealhub's support for ticket and conversation feeds from the widest range of FX dealing services, including Reuters Dealing, EBS Spot, EBS Trader, EBS Prime, Voice Broker DDN, FXall, Currenex,FX Connect and Garban ICAP ETC.


  • DealHub’s ability to map incoming tickets and supply them in a standard output format (DealHub supports output in a wide range of formats including Reuters TOF, XML and MT300 and using a variety of protocols, e.g. Websphere MQ, Reuters TOF, MSMQ, Reuters Triarch, TIBCO ETX / Rendezvous).


  • Tried and tested software already in use by major players.


  • High throughput capability.
